nurse call points play a crucial role in healthcare facilities by providing patients with a way to communicate their needs to healthcare providers quickly and efficiently. These devices have evolved over the years to include advanced features that enhance patient care and improve communication between patients and nurses. In this article, we will discuss the importance of nurse call points in healthcare facilities and how they benefit both patients and healthcare providers.
One of the primary functions of nurse call points is to provide patients with a way to summon help when they need it. This could be for something as simple as needing a glass of water or as urgent as experiencing a medical emergency. By simply pressing a button on the nurse call point, patients can alert nursing staff to their needs and receive prompt assistance. This quick response time can be critical in emergency situations where every second counts.
nurse call points also help to improve the overall efficiency of healthcare facilities by streamlining communication between patients and nurses. Instead of patients having to rely on verbal communication or physical signals to get the attention of nursing staff, they can simply press a button and have their needs addressed promptly. This not only saves time for nurses, allowing them to prioritize patient care more effectively, but also ensures that patients receive the care they need in a timely manner.
In addition to improving communication and efficiency, nurse call points also enhance patient safety in healthcare facilities. By providing patients with a direct line of communication to nursing staff, these devices help to prevent accidents and medical errors that could result from delays in receiving necessary care. Patients can quickly notify nurses of any changes in their condition or request assistance with mobility, preventing falls and other safety risks.
Furthermore, nurse call points are designed to be user-friendly and accessible to patients of all ages and abilities. They typically feature large buttons that are easy to press, as well as visual and auditory indicators to confirm that the call has been received. This ensures that patients with limited mobility or cognitive impairments can still use the device effectively to communicate their needs to nursing staff.
Modern nurse call points are also equipped with advanced features that further enhance their functionality and usability. Some models are integrated with nurse call systems that automatically route calls to the appropriate staff members based on the patient’s location or level of urgency. This ensures that patients receive the right level of care in a timely manner, without the need for manual intervention by nursing staff.
Additionally, nurse call points can be integrated with other healthcare technologies, such as electronic health records and telemetry systems, to provide a more comprehensive view of patient needs and ensure continuity of care. This seamless integration allows nursing staff to access patient information quickly and make informed decisions about patient care, leading to better outcomes for patients overall.
